What Does "BN" Mean?
"Brand new."
In the context of item condition, "BN" means "brand new". Visually, it looks exactly like it would on the shelf in a retail store. The item is new and unused, but doesn't have any kind of retail packaging that would allow it to be classed as BNIB, BNIP or BNWT. In some cases, the retail barcode may even be printed directly onto the item. There's no wear or damage of any kind. Item is fully functional.
